2. The VIP Zone: What Makes It Different?

Regular players may enjoy the main floor, but VIPs go somewhere else entirely—into private gaming rooms known as “salons,” “high-limit lounges,” or “Paiza rooms.” These areas are not publicly accessible and require either an invitation or extremely high bankroll.
Here’s what typically distinguishes a VIP zone in 2025:
1. Private Gaming Rooms with Personalized Dealers
Instead of crowded tables, VIP players enjoy:
• Quiet, soundproof rooms
• Private blackjack, baccarat, or roulette tables
• Personal dealers trained in etiquette and multiple languages
• Adjustable table limits starting from tens of thousands per hand
VIP dealers are also trained to remember player preferences—from betting styles to beverage choices.

3. Ultra-Luxury Suites: Where VIP Players Stay

Playing is only part of the VIP experience. Most casinos offer extravagant suites where players rest between gaming sessions.
In 2025, VIP suites in top-tier casinos may feature:
• Indoor jacuzzi or private spa treatment rooms
• In-room cinema
• Private gyms
• Automated smart-room systems
• Billion-dollar skyline views
At casinos like Wynn Palace and Marina Bay Sands, VIPs can even enjoy private infinity pools attached to the suite.

5. VIP Technology Upgrades in 2025
Casinos in 2025 are heavily integrating technology to enhance the VIP experience. For instance:
• AI-driven personalization systems prepare everything from room temperature to preferred games.
• Facial recognition speeds up check-ins, bypassing crowds.
• Smart gaming tables track bets and trends for players who want statistics.
• AR/VR entertainment suites add immersive relaxation options between sessions.
VIP players benefit the most, as these tools are often available exclusively in premium zones.
